CES 2026 stands as the most important global stage for consumer technology, innovation, and future-defining trends. Held annually in Las Vegas, the Consumer Electronics Show has evolved far beyond a gadget expo. In 2026, CES represents a convergence point for artificial intelligence, robotics, digital health, mobility, smart living, sustainability, and immersive experiences—offering a clear roadmap for where technology is heading next.

CES 2026 at a Glance

CES 2026 brings together:

  • Thousands of global exhibitors
  • Technology leaders, startups, and investors
  • Media, creators, and policymakers
  • Innovations spanning consumer, enterprise, and industrial tech

More than any previous year, CES 2026 reflects a shift from experimental technology to real-world, scalable, and human-centric solutions.

Artificial Intelligence Dominates CES 2026

AI Moves From Feature to Foundation

Artificial Intelligence is no longer a standalone category at CES 2026—it is the foundation of nearly every innovation on display.

Key AI trends include:

  • On-device AI enabling faster performance, stronger privacy, and offline intelligence
  • Edge AI reducing dependence on cloud computing
  • Context-aware AI systems that understand user behavior, environment, and intent
  • Generative AI integration across devices, vehicles, and smart environments

From laptops and smartphones to home appliances and healthcare tools, AI at CES 2026 is embedded, invisible, and practical.

Robotics Enters Everyday Life

From Concept to Consumer Reality

Robotics at CES 2026 marks a turning point. Robots are no longer confined to factories or research labs—they are entering homes, hospitals, warehouses, and service industries.

Highlighted robotics applications include:

  • Domestic robots capable of cleaning, organizing, and assisting with daily chores
  • Service robots for hospitality, retail, and eldercare
  • Industrial robots enhanced by AI vision and autonomous decision-making
  • Humanoid robotics focused on human interaction and adaptability

The defining theme is Physical AI—robots that understand and interact with the physical world in intelligent, adaptive ways.

Smart Home Technology Becomes Truly Intelligent

Beyond Connected Devices

CES 2026 demonstrates that smart homes are no longer about controlling devices—they are about orchestrating experiences.

Key developments include:

  • AI-driven home hubs that learn user routines
  • Predictive automation for lighting, climate, and energy use
  • Advanced home security systems with real-time threat recognition
  • Seamless interoperability across brands and ecosystems

Smart homes in 2026 focus on anticipation, personalization, and efficiency, rather than manual control.

Automotive Innovation Takes Center Stage

The Car as an Intelligent Digital Space

CES 2026 reinforces the automotive industry’s transformation into a technology-first ecosystem.

Major automotive trends include:

  • AI-powered in-car assistants
  • Intelligent dashboards with personalized interfaces
  • Advanced driver-assistance systems (ADAS)
  • Autonomous driving software and sensor fusion
  • Electric vehicle innovation and smart charging solutions

Vehicles are no longer just transportation—they are becoming connected, adaptive environments that integrate entertainment, productivity, safety, and wellness.

Display Technology Reaches New Extremes

Performance, Immersion, and Design

Display innovation remains a CES cornerstone, and 2026 pushes visual technology to new limits.

Key display trends include:

  • Ultra-high refresh rate gaming monitors
  • Next-generation OLED and Micro-LED panels
  • Enhanced color accuracy and brightness
  • Flexible, transparent, and wireless display concepts
  • Immersive visual environments for work and entertainment

Displays at CES 2026 are designed not only for entertainment but also for professional creativity, gaming, healthcare visualization, and immersive collaboration.

Digital Health and Wearables Redefined

From Fitness Tracking to Preventive Care

Health technology at CES 2026 focuses on early detection, continuous monitoring, and personalized wellness.

Notable innovations include:

  • AI-powered wearables that track long-term health trends
  • Smart sensors capable of identifying early signs of disease
  • Remote patient monitoring solutions
  • Mental health and cognitive wellness technologies
  • Elder-care and assisted-living systems

The health tech shift is clear: technology designed to support longer, healthier lives.

Sustainability and Energy Innovation

Responsible Technology Takes Priority

As AI and digital infrastructure demand more power, CES 2026 highlights sustainability as a core theme.

Key sustainability initiatives include:

  • Energy-efficient hardware design
  • Smart energy management systems
  • Renewable power solutions
  • Sustainable materials and circular manufacturing
  • AI-driven optimization for power consumption

Green technology is no longer optional—it is becoming a competitive advantage.
